PhD researcher in explainable machine learning and survival analysis

The PhD project consists of two main parts. First part, is about fundamental research on the intersection between interaction learning and survival analysis. In particular, interaction learning deals with predicting or clustering interactions between two sets of objects. Survival analysis is rooted in statistics and deals with predicting the time until an event occurs. The focus is on the development of new algorithms for prediction and clustering in this context. Second, the algorithms will be applied in the context of developing smart alarms in an intensive care unit. Given the current overload of alarms, it will contribute to reduce alarm fatigue in clinical staff and alarm anxiety. For this purpose, the algorithms will be applied on real data from the local hospital.
